All eyes will be on Arsenal this afternoon, with the Gunners travelling to Old Trafford in the first of their double Gameweek fixtures. Meanwhile, Man City look to strengthen their hold on second place when they lock horns with Swansea at the Liberty in the earlier lunchtime kick off.

Swansea face a tough task trying to contain the league’s form forward, Sergio Aguero, when the Sky Blues pay a visit. The Argentinian marksman boasts eight goals in five starts for City, having registered a hat-trick and two assists last time out. David Silva has also delivered strong Fantasy returns in recent weeks, notching one goal and three assists in his last two starts. However, Garry Monk’s may just have an ace of their own up their sleeves, with leading striker Bafetimbi Gomis scoring a dramatic late winner on his return from injury against Arsenal. The former Lyon marksman tallied four goals in as many appearances and will threaten a City defence seeking their fourth shut-out in five Gameweeks.

Manchester United recovered from a three-match losing streak last weekend, recording a 2-1 win over Crystal Palace at Selhurst Park. Juan Mata (four goals in seven) and Marouane Fellaini (three goals in eight) account for the Red Devils’ only two goals in the past four Gameweeks, in light of Wayne Rooney failing to net in five. Olivier Giroud is experiencing a similar downturn in form for visitors Arsenal – having drawn blanks in four consecutive matches; Alexis Sanchez has partly compensated for Giroud’s demise, with three goals in five starts. Meanwhile, Aaron Ramsey has been the North Londoners’ most consistent player of late, delivering attacking returns in four of his previous seven outings. The Welshman is a slight injury doubt going into today’s encounter, with Fantasy managers eagerly anticipating Arsene Wenger’s teatime teamsheet.
